The Impact of Large Hotel Chains

Alnwick has always been a charming, welcoming destination, with independent guest houses like ours offering a personal touch that large hotel chains simply can’t replicate. However, the arrival of Premier Inn and the broader economic climate have made running a small hospitality business increasingly challenging.

Since its opening, we’ve noticed a decline in our winter bookings. Their large-scale operation attracts budget-conscious travelers, making it harder for independent guest houses like ours to compete—especially when we’re facing rising energy prices, increased mortgage rates, and higher staffing and laundry costs.

“After years of running successful guest houses in Alnwick, I now find myself struggling to make a profit. The cost of keeping the business running has soared, yet our ability to adjust pricing is limited by corporate competition. This isn’t just about business—it’s about preserving the character of Alnwick’s independent accommodation scene.”

The Impact of Large Hotel Chains on Small Towns

Large hotel chains have deep pockets, allowing them to offer lower rates, extensive marketing, and nationwide booking systems that independent establishments simply cannot match. While they provide convenient accommodation, they also shift visitor spending away from locally owned businesses, impacting the entire community.

A 2023 tourism report from Visit Northumberland found that while visitor numbers in the county rose by 1.4% to 10.12 million, independent accommodations are struggling to capture their fair share of the market. Chains like Premier Inn are absorbing a significant portion of overnight stays, leaving guest houses with fewer bookings, especially during off-peak seasons.

The Rising Costs of Running an Independent Guest House

Beyond competition, the economic climate is making it harder for guest houses to remain sustainable. The costs of:

  • Energy – Heating and electricity bills have surged, putting extra strain on small businesses.
  • Mortgages – Rising interest rates have significantly increased monthly payments.
  • Staffing – Higher wages and employment costs mean tighter profit margins.
  • Laundry and Cleaning – Essential services that have become considerably more expensive.

With these pressures mounting, independent guest houses find themselves in a difficult position—absorbing costs without the corporate backing that large chains enjoy.

Additionally, booking directly through the guest house’s official website rather than third-party booking platformsensures more of the revenue goes directly to the business. Many online travel agencies like Booking.com run sponsored ads using the guest house’s name, but these often lead to higher commission fees for the owner. Checking for the official website and booking direct helps independent businesses remain competitive and sustainable.
